Description
Culture is an important contextual variable in information systems (IS) research. As more and more people across different countries, organizations, and regions use information systems and technologies it is important to take culture into consideration in IS design and implementation. There are very few comprehensive literature reviews in the area of culture in IS research. We address this need by examining the literature using an innovative text mining approach.
